Softball Splits Pair to Win Weekend Series Against Holy Cross

How It Happened
Rhode Island got its second walk-off win in as many days to help the Rams earn a doubleheader split Saturday afternoon. After dropping the first game 7-1, Rhody (2-10) came back and took the second contest 2-1 to win the weekend series.

Game 1 – Holy Cross 7, Rhode Island 1
In a game that was closer than the final indicated, Rhody led 1-0 through the first three innings, thanks to a solo home run from Alex Pleasic.

Holy Cross (1-2) got single runs in the fourth, fifth and sixth innings to take a 3-1 lead into the final frame. The Crusaders scored four in the top of the seventh, two of which came on an Erin Bengston two-run double, to ice the game.

Game 2 – Rhode Island 2, Holy Cross 1
Rhody loaded the bases with singles from Alex Pleasic, Ari Castillo and Susan Harrison before Cassie Swenson came up with two outs. Swenson lofted a high fly ball to left field that was dropped by the Holy Cross outfielder, allowing Pleasic to come in with the winning run.

Sophomore Piper Maguire went the distance for her second strong start of the weekend to earn the first victory of her career.

Inside the Box Score
  • Sophomore Piper Maguire pitched 7.0 innings in the second game for the first complete game of her career. She allowed just four hits and one run while striking out a pair.
  • In the series, Maguire hurled 13.0 innings, giving up four runs on 12 hits. She is now 1-1 in her career.
  • Junior Susan Harrison had a big day at the plate, going 3-for-5 with a double, one walk and one sacrifice bunt.
  • Redshirt senior Alex Pleasic had a home run, double, single and two runs scored on the day. She scored one run in each game.
  • Senior Hannah DeSousa doubled, singled and had one RBI.
  • Junior Ari Castillo and redshirt senior Erica Robles both had two singles. Castillo also was hit by a pitch.
  • Redshirt junior Abby Fenbert delivered a pinch-hit single in the second game.
